Honors Program

The PHHP College Honors Program consists of three levels: cum laude (honors), magna cum laude (high honors), and summa cum laude (highest honors). Students seeking to graduate with honors must apply by the deadline in the fall semester of their junior year.

Scholars Program

The University Scholars Program introduces undergraduate students at the University of Florida to the exciting world of academic research. In the program, students work one-on-one with UF faculty on selected research projects. Through this initiative, students will take away an understanding of and appreciation for the scholarly method.

Study Abroad

UF in The Gambia: Health and Culture in West Africa is an immersive, faculty-led study abroad experience that aims to provide students with a comprehensive understanding of the complex interplay between health, culture, and society in The Gambia.


Variable credit courses

The College of Public Health and Health Professions offers three variable credit courses each semester that can be taken for 0-4 credits, depending on the course. Students cannot register themselves for these courses but instead must complete and submit paperwork by the second day of drop/add to be registered. The three courses are described below.

Clinical Observation

HSC 3801 Clinical Observation (1-4 credits; Satisfactory/Unsatisfactory) is where you shadow a health professional. For every credit you register for, you are expected to complete 50 hours of observation over the duration of the semester. You can shadow multiple professionals and/or shadow at multiple places (does not have to be in Gainesville), however there is additional paperwork for each additional professional or location. It is the student’s responsibility to arrange who and where they will shadow. Additionally, the student agrees to submit a one-page double-spaced journal to the PHHP faculty supervisor (minimum five submissions) every three weeks reflecting upon what they’ve observed, and emphasizing aspects like patient-provider communication, differential diagnosis, professional ethics, the provider’s different roles, etc. Each journal should emailed directly to the PHHP faculty supervisor.

To request registration:

  1. Contact a site or sites to establish if you can observe a health provider, the number of hours you can observe, and whether it’s feasible to obtain those hours over the course of the upcoming semester.  
  2. Identify a PHHP faculty member who is willing to serve as your academic supervisor for your clinical observation.
  3. Complete the Contractual Agreement Form with the faculty and the health care provider and get their signatures.
  4. Upon receipt of completed form, you will be registered for the course. 

Independent Study

HSC 4905 Independent Study (1-4 credits; Letter Grade) is where you and a faculty member conceptualize a non-research based project that has to do with your professional development and/or personal growth. For example, may you read a book on a topic of interest and discuss the book with the faculty multiple times throughout the semester. Or, for example, you could interview various health professionals in the field you are pursuing and get a sense of their pathway through graduate school or getting a job. For each credit you register for, you either complete an additional project or the single project become larger in scope.

To request registration:

  1. Identify a PHHP faculty member who is willing to work with you for an Independent Study.
  2. Complete the Contractual Agreement Form with the faculty and get the faculty member’s signature.
  3. Upon receipt of completed form, you will be registered for the course. 

Supervised Research

HSC 4913 Supervised Research (0-4 credits; Letter Grade) is where you assist a PHHP faculty member with a research project that they are currently doing or plan to do. That is, you do not create a research project on your own but rather work with a PHHP faculty member. Like clinical observation, 1 credit is equivalent to 50 hours of time over the duration of the semester.

To request registration:

  1. Identify a PHHP faculty member who is willing to work with you for Supervised Research.
  2. Complete the Contractual Agreement Form with the faculty and get the faculty member’s signature.
  3. Upon receipt of completed form, you will be registered for the course.
